#0df1dd basic color information

#0df1dd

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#0df1dd has decimal index of: 913885, is composed of 5.1% red, 94.5% green and 86.7% blue. #0df1dd in CMYK color model, is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 5.5% black.
#00ffcc is the closest web-safe color to #0df1dd.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
